If you're looking for a fun and festive Easter treat that is both vegan and gluten-free, then these Rice Krispies Easter eggs are the perfect option. Made with just a few simple ingredients, these eggs are not only delicious and allergy-friendly, but also easy to make. Simply mix together some gluten-free crispy rice cereal, vegan marshmallows, and coconut oil, and mold them into egg shapes. Then, decorate them with colorful frosting and sprinkles for a fun and tasty Easter treat that everyone can enjoy.

If you're a fan of the classic combination of peanut butter and chocolate, then these healthy homemade peanut butter Easter eggs are a must-try. Made with all-natural ingredients and no added sugars, these eggs are a guilt-free indulgence for your Easter celebrations. Simply mix together some natural peanut butter, almond flour, and maple syrup, and shape them into egg shapes. Then, dip them in melted dark chocolate and let them set in the fridge. These eggs are not only delicious, but also packed with protein and healthy fats.

The Perfect Vegan Brunch Recipe for Easter

Ingredients:

  • 1 cup of quinoa
  • 1 can of chickpeas
  • 1 red bell pepper, diced
  • 1 yellow bell pepper, diced
  • 1 small red onion, diced
  • 1 avocado, diced
  • 1/4 cup of chopped cilantro
  • 1/4 cup of pumpkin seeds
  • 1/4 cup of dried cranberries
  • 1/4 cup of sliced almonds
  • 1/4 cup of chopped walnuts
  • 1 tablespoon of olive oil
  • 1 tablespoon of lemon juice
  • 1 teaspoon of honey
  • 1 teaspoon of apple cider vinegar
  • Salt and pepper to taste

Instructions:

  1. Start by cooking the quinoa according to package instructions. Once cooked, set it aside to cool.
  2. In a large pan, heat the olive oil over medium heat. Add the diced bell peppers and red onion, and sauté until they start to soften.
  3. Add the chickpeas to the pan and cook until they are slightly crispy.
  4. In a small bowl, mix together the lemon juice, honey, and apple cider vinegar to make the dressing.
  5. In a large mixing bowl, combine the cooked quinoa, sautéed vegetables and chickpeas, and the dressing. Mix well.
  6. Add in the avocado, pumpkin seeds, dried cranberries, sliced almonds, and chopped walnuts. Mix gently to avoid mashing the avocado.
  7. Season with salt and pepper to taste.
  8. Sprinkle the chopped cilantro on top as a garnish.
  9. Serve the quinoa and chickpea salad as a hearty and healthy vegan brunch option.

This dish not only looks beautiful with its vibrant colors, but it also packs a punch of nutrients. Quinoa is a complete protein, which means it contains all nine essential amino acids. Chickpeas are a great source of plant-based protein and are also high in fiber. The combination of nuts and seeds adds a satisfying crunch and healthy fats to the dish. The dressing adds a tangy and sweet flavor to balance out the savory elements.
